Can I clean this pan in the dishwasher?
Hand washing your anodized aluminum bakeware is recommended. A majority of commercial dish washing detergents contain harsh chemicals and phosphates that can discolor the surface of the pan. The same may be caused by bleach, oven cleaners, and other caustic cleaning agents. Avoid the use of aggressive chemicals to maintain the beauty of your Fat Daddio's anodized aluminum bakeware. Refer to the Care Instructions resource provided for recommended cleaning methods.
What is the benefit of anodized aluminum bakeware?
Aluminum bakeware itself is ideal for baking delicate desserts due to its heat-reflective properties. Because it does not absorb heat, it quickly reaches baking temperature and cools more quickly than other materials like steel. Anodizing takes aluminum bakeware a step further, effectively sealing the porous surface of aluminum, creating a non-reactive surface that increases the versatility of the pan and prevents the absorption of fat, sugar, oil, and cleaning agents. Anodizing is a safe and durable non-coating that does not contain any harmful components and protects against chipping, flaking, peeling, and rusting to ensure the longevity of the bakeware.
Why should I bake in a 3" or 4" deep cake pan?
Baking in a deeper pan may save you time and energy and allow you to achieve optimal results. Baking a single cake layer at 3" or 4" deep eliminates the need to bake multiple smaller layers and minimizes carving time as there is no need to work with more than one layer. When stacking, using multiple 3" or 4" layers allows for greater stability when torting compared to using multiple 2" cake layers. This advantage is especially pronounced when you intend to use layers 6" or taller. Additionally, the deeper pans bake cakes more slowly, creating a more dense cake that holds together better in general.

Anodized aluminum delivers exceptional performance and consistent results so you can bake with confidence. Anodizing is not a chemical coating, but a process that provides a more durable and versatile baking surface that resists abrasion and will not rust, peel, or flake and contaminate your food. The anodizing process seals the natural pores of aluminum, creating a safer baking surface that doesn't rely on chemical coatings or contain extra metals. Unlike conventional aluminum or steel bakeware which may react poorly with acidic foods, the non-reactive surface of anodized aluminum makes it compatible with a wider variety of recipes including those with citrus ingredients.
